位置: 首页 > 要怎么办

excel if嵌套函数怎么用-excel 条件嵌套函数技巧

作者:佚名
|
1人看过
发布时间:2026-06-07 06:57:47
Excel IF 嵌套函数怎么用综合 在数据处理与逻辑分析日益复杂的职场环境中,Excel 作为信息处理的核心工具,其逻辑处理能力至关重要。而 IF 嵌套函数,作为 Excel 中最经典、应用最
Excel IF 嵌套函数怎么用综合 在数据处理与逻辑分析日益复杂的职场环境中,Excel 作为信息处理的核心工具,其逻辑处理能力至关重要。而 IF 嵌套函数,作为 Excel 中最经典、应用最广泛的逻辑函数之一,构成了数据分析的基石。从简单的条件判断到多层级的复杂决策,IF 嵌套函数不仅极大地提升了工作效率,更在金融建模、数据清洗、报告生成等实际场景中扮演了关键角色。它赋予用户“条件即逻辑”的自由度,使得枯燥的数据自动筛选、动态取值和复杂规则判断不再是难题。 初学者往往在处理复杂的嵌套逻辑时容易陷入误区,导致公式难以看懂或运行出错。掌握 IF 嵌套函数的精髓,不仅需要熟悉语法结构,更需要理解变量间的关联关系以及结果反传机制。通过系统学习与实战演练,可以构建起强大的数据处理思维,从而在日益数据密集的职场中游刃有余。 基础架构与核心逻辑解析 要驾驭 IF 嵌套函数,首先必须厘清其基本运作原理。IF 函数的核心在于提供两个条件,并据此决定返回一个或多个结果。其标准公式结构为 `=IF(条件,结果1,结果 2)`。在简单情况下,若条件为真,则返回结果 1;若为假,则返回结果 2。这种真假分明的逻辑框架,是构建所有嵌套函数的起点。 当我们将 IF 函数与其他函数结合使用时,其逻辑链条便会延伸。
例如,当条件本身又是一个判断时,就形成了 IF 嵌套。此时,Excel 会先判断外层条件,若成立则进入内层逻辑;若失败,则直接返回外层默认值。这种层层递进的判断机制,使得原本简单的“或”、“非”、“且”等逻辑关系得以自动化实现。理解这一基础逻辑至关重要,因为只有透彻掌握了单一层的逻辑流转,才能轻松应对多层的复杂性。 实战案例一:课堂成绩与等级评定 在实际工作中,判断学生成绩并给出相应等级是高频场景。假设某班级共有 100 名学生,成绩表名为 `A` 列。我们需要根据成绩区间自动划分等级。 场景描述: 成绩在 80 分以上为 "A",60-79 分为 "B",60 分以下(含 60)为 "C" 或 "D"。 操作步骤:
1.在 B 列输入公式 `=IF(A1>=80,"A",IF(A1>=60,"B","C"))`。
2.在 B2 单元格输入公式,使其向下填充至 B100。 解析: 外层判断 `A1>=80` 成立,返回 "A";不成立,进入内层判断 `A1>=60`。若成立,返回 "B";不成立,返回 "C"。通过层层的嵌套,实现了对成绩区间的高效分类。注意,此处使用了引号将等级文字包裹,确保输出为文本而非数值,避免后续计算时产生逻辑混淆。 实战案例二:多维筛选与部门绩效分析 除了单一维度的条件判断,多条件联合判断是处理复杂数据的关键。
例如,我们需要从销售人员表中筛选出“销售额超过 100000 且所属部门为销售部且 2023 年度奖金超过年薪 10% 的员工”,并显示其具体奖金数额。 操作步骤:
1.在 B 列输入公式 `=IF(A2>=100000 & C2="销售部" & (B2>=A21.1),B2,0)`。
2.在 B3 单元格输入公式,使其向下填充至 B100。 解析: 利用 `&` 符号连接不同条件。公式逻辑为:若 A、C、B 三项同时满足,则返回 B 列数据(奖金);否则返回 0。这种多层嵌套不仅支持了逻辑与的操作,还通过 0 的返回保证了数据整洁。 进阶技巧: 若需判断"2023 年度奖金超过年薪 10%",在 Excel 中需将年份转换为数字处理。假设 2023 年份标记为 `20230101`,年薪为 `200000`,则公式变为 `=IF(A2>=100000 & C2="销售部" & (B2>=2000001.1),B2,0)`。这展示了如何将文本与日期序列进行数值比较,是 IF 嵌套进阶应用的重要一环。 嵌套层次控制与常见陷阱 随着嵌套层数的增加,公式的结构会变得愈发复杂,且容易出现逻辑错误。必须明确每一层 IF 函数的角色。内层函数主要负责处理更精细的条件,外层函数则负责宏观的筛选或分流。 要注意“结果传递”问题。在多重嵌套中,若条件不成立,外层函数必须确保返回合理的默认值(如 `0`、`""` 或 `""""`),防止整个公式返回错误值(N/A 或 VALUE!)。例如 `=IF(A1=1, "A", IF(A1=2, "B", IF(A1=3, "C", "")))`,若 A1 未填值,最终将返回空串。 警惕函数名冲突与参数错位。在嵌套过程中,务必保持函数名清晰,避免内外层逻辑混淆。
于此同时呢,检查单元格的引用路径是否正确,特别是在跨列或跨行跳转时,行号或列标需注意区分,防止访问到错误数据。 自动化报表生成与数据处理 除了单项逻辑判断,IF 嵌套函数在自动化报表生成中发挥着不可替代的作用。在实际办公场景中,常需根据一系列条件动态生成不同格式的报表。 具体应用: 制作一份“销售业绩监控表”。先建立主表,列头为产品、数量、单价、总金额。再在次表中利用 IF 嵌套函数,根据主表数据生成汇总表。 操作步骤:
1.在主表 B 列输入数据。
2.在次表 C 列输入公式 `=SUMIF(A:A, 主表 B 列引用, 主表 D 列引用)`。
3.若需动态展示某类产品的盈亏情况,可使用 `=IF(总利润<0, "亏损", "盈利")` 进行辅助说明。 这种“主表 - 次表”的联动结构,极大地简化了复杂数据表的构建过程。通过将复杂的判断逻辑封装在单元格公式中,不仅提高了数据更新效率,还确保了报表始终反映最新业务状态,减少了人工核对的误差。 高级应用场景:动态阈值与条件聚合 在更复杂的业务场景中,如预算控制和资源配置,IF 嵌套函数的威力得以充分释放。通过动态计算阈值,可以实现自主化的决策支持。 应用场景: 设定月度销售预算任务。若总销售额低于预算,则自动触发预警;若超额,则显示超额部分。 操作步骤:
1.输入公式 `=IF(Sales<=Budget,"任务完成",IF(Sales<=Budget1.2,"超额","超支"))`。
2.若需处理分组数据(如按产品类别统计),可结合 `SUMIFS` 与 IF 嵌套,实现条件分组求和。 此外,在处理表格数据清洗时,IF 嵌套也发挥着重要作用。
例如,自动去除无效单元格或合并重复项,这些操作往往依赖于条件逻辑的精确匹配,正是 IF 函数擅长的领域。 总结 ,Excel IF 嵌套函数不仅是 Excel 中的“逻辑引擎”,更是提升数据处理能力的关键利器。从基础的单层判断到多层级的复杂逻辑,从单条件筛选到多维报表生成,IF 函数的应用无处不在。掌握其核心逻辑,理解嵌套与层级关系,避免常见陷阱,是深入运用该功能的前提。通过不断的练习与实战,您将能够构建起高效、自动化的数据处理体系,从而在复杂的职场环境中游刃有余,释放数据价值,创造更佳的工作效能。
推荐文章
相关文章
推荐URL
应对慢性胃炎胃胀气的综合策略与实用指南 在慢性胃炎与胃胀气困扰的诊疗领域,面对患者长期不适却难以缓解的困境,需首先从病理生理层面做出深刻理解。慢性胃炎不仅仅是胃黏膜的防御反应,更是一种涉及分泌、吸收
2026-05-25
16 人看过
小孩胃胀气难受怎么办:科学应对指南 在家长带孩子就医或自行护理时,对于孩子出现胃胀、肚子不舒服的情况,往往感到既焦虑又困惑。很多家长误以为只要把气放出来就好了,或者盲目使用止泻药,这种“头痛医头”的
2026-05-26
11 人看过
闪电宝刷卡怎么用是移动支付与金融创新领域近年来备受关注的实践案例。作为界域职考网xinlishi.cc专注闪电宝刷卡怎么用10余年的行业专家,我们深入剖析了这一技术突破背后的逻辑、应用方式及其带来的深
2026-05-31
8 人看过
深度解析 B 站封面制作尺寸与艺术规范 在 B 站(哔哩哔哩)的浩瀚内容生态中,封面图片早已超越了简单的视觉展示,已成为内容传播的核心载体。优秀的封面能够瞬间抓住用户的注意力,决定点击率的高低与后续
2026-05-25
7 人看过